Output ed5d4b83e79e63f7fa26afc44ef6f5d4e9869c25d49fa2136c12ef5736796d26:1

value
556652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eb680eabe41ea5127712697af317842feac0c1c OP_EQUAL
address
38sDG5TeGPNMLZeEvhyu4AUWR481iJvTgK
transaction
ed5d4b83e79e63f7fa26afc44ef6f5d4e9869c25d49fa2136c12ef5736796d26
spent
true